Freight, Customs and Timing
Split mech mod shipments across two sailings when the order is large enough. It costs slightly more but removes the risk of a single event wiping out a full quarter of stock.
Ask your forwarder for the mech mod transit history on your lane, not the advertised schedule. The gap between the two is the buffer you should build into your reorder point.

Reading a Mech Mod Spec Sheet
Ask any factory for the same mech mod sample twice, three months apart. If the second sample drifts, the production line is running without statistical control and your reviews will drift with it. Consistency over time is a more useful signal than a single good sample.
When we write a mech mod specification with a distributor, we fix four things first: the resistance band, the liquid capacity tolerance, the puff count methodology and the packaging master carton. Everything else can flex without changing the customer experience.

How should mech mod be stored?
Cool, dry and out of direct sunlight. Heat and light are the two things that shorten shelf life fastest. Rotate stock by batch code rather than by arrival date, and keep cartons off concrete floors in humid warehouses.
What if a batch does not match the sample?
Keep the retained samples from the approval stage. If a delivered batch measurably differs, we compare against the retained set and resolve it against the production record. This is why we insist on sealed retained units from every run.
